For Sale / Pescador pilot 120 For Sale
« on: December 08, 2018, 11:39:08 AM »
With 2 kayaks and a jon boat.. someone has gotta go. I bought this kayak new about 6 months before buying my radar 135. Hoped the wife would use this one but that never came to be.. so I bought a boat so her and the kid can come with me from time to time. I used this guy a total of seven months in the napa river, hennessy and berryessa. She's in great shape, and the pedal drive works great. Minor scratches from launching on the bottom but nothing of significance. I also swapped out the original rudder cable that is known for breaking, and swapped it out with 400lb steel leader that has ran great. Also including a paddle, yak attack leverloc anchor trolley and two yak gear flush mount rod holders that I never got around to installing. With that also, I have a wall mount kayak holder (Rad sport brand) that can go with it if you plan to hang the kayak. It's been sitting for long enough, and is ready for a new home. Great for first time fisherman or those who want to shy from the paddle. Asking 1300$ OBO. paid 1800$ plus tax for the kayak alone. Hit hennessy on Saturday,  got 5 in the boat, 4.5 if you go by size on the little guy.  Lost two getting in the net and one to deep to see the guy,  but from the fight I'd estimate a 30 lb small mouth..🤪 lol. my buddy killed it out there last weekend and it's been really picking up with worms and spinner baits in 5ft of water.  Guy from shore said he nailed one in just a couple of feet off water that was shy of 5lbs. Great lake for people on kayaks.
      Went on the napa river for about two hours today and got a 24in striper trolling, pretty fish.  Gonna get him on the fryer this week,  just went out to scout around really.

When out today and got a couple schoolies , but a few guys came in on boats with limits for everybody aboard.  Trolling rattle traps for striper. Really picking up compared to what its been.. from what I've been hearing.
